Read More2017.2.13 CERAMIC LINED BALL MILL. Ball Mills can be supplied with either ceramic or rubber linings for wet or dry grinding, for continuous or batch type operation, in sizes from 15″ x 21″ to 8′ x 12′. High density ceramic linings of uniform hardness male possible thinner linings and greater and more effective grinding volume.

Read More2023.5.15 Ball-mills are categorized into four types depending on the motion generated to produce momentum in grinding balls and act upon the material with various milling forces. These are planetary, tumbling, vibratory, and attrition mills. 3.1. Planetary ball mill. Planetary ball mills are simple and efficient in producing ground/pulverized material.
